conservative
[kənˈsərvədiv]
ADJECTIVE
averse to change or innovation and holding traditional values.
"they were very conservative in their outlook"
synonyms:
traditionalist · traditional · conventional · orthodox · stable · old-fashioned · [more]
(in a political context) favoring free enterprise, private ownership, and socially traditional ideas.Often contrasted with liberal.
synonyms:
right-wing · reactionary · traditionalist · unprogressive · establishmentarian · [more]
(of an estimate) purposely low for the sake of caution.
"the film was not cheap—$30,000 is a conservative estimate"
synonyms:
low · cautious · understated · unexaggerated · moderate · reasonable
(of surgery or medical treatment) intended to control rather than eliminate a condition, with existing tissue preserved as far as possible.
NOUN
a person who is averse to change and holds traditional values.
"he was considered a conservative in his approach to Catholic teachings"
synonyms:
right-winger · reactionary · rightist · diehard · Tory · Republican
a person favoring free enterprise, private ownership, and socially traditional ideas.Often contrasted with liberal.
"the Massachusetts liberal who conservatives love to hate"
